Comments (7)
I did create a rubygem (vimwiki_markdown) if you want to try that. It's very much a work in progress and does require some config, but it's working for me!
from vimwiki.
For the record: there is a promising attempt to standardize markdown syntax here: http://commonmark.org/
from vimwiki.
I currently use a custom php script convert markdown to html (use custom_wiki2html option), additionally vimwiki link is [link] instead [link](link)
, so standard markdown parser couldn't create link properly, the custom script needs to address this issue too.
from vimwiki.
One more thing, diary index page isn't good for markdown neither.
from vimwiki.
I've found the following thread hugely helpful in getting a good automatic markdown->html export set up.
https://gist.github.com/maikeldotuk/54a91c21ed9623705fdce7bab2989742#gistcomment-3109060
from vimwiki.
I'm doing pip3 install vimwiki_markdown
and in my config: 'custom_wiki2html': 'vimwiki_markdown'
+ 'syntax': 'markdown', 'ext': '.md'
would be nice if vimwiki would handle it natively tho.
from vimwiki.
pandoc is the recommended way of doing. Here is my wiki2html. There is the same in the doc.
As of 2020, there is still no native markdown conversion
If someone is willing to create a vimscript for the conversion mdforvim may be a good start.
Meanwhile, I prefer to close, just to narrow the dev scope.
from vimwiki.
Related Issues (20)
- VimWiki and Goyo HOT 1
- Failure in Exapanding snippets/Ultisnips in inline math mode of vimwiki
- Improve docs for opening links in existing split: How to give [reuse] Argument to VimwikiSplitLink? HOT 2
- Is it possible to make enter on GitHub links go to repo in filesystem? HOT 1
- (neovim) Vimwiki always creates .wiki files instead of .md HOT 2
- How can I disable VimWiki's table mode? HOT 1
- vimwiki_tags not generated for markdown syntax files
- Macro slows down with each iteration HOT 4
- VimWiki "Wiki" section in Github allows everyone to create pages HOT 2
- Addition of new line is not reflected in conversion from .wiki to .html HOT 1
- Help setting different dirs from diary and zk
- Link works for VIM 9.0 but report error for VIM 9.1
- Links that line wrap are badly formatted HOT 3
- VimwikiSearchTags does not work with empty `pre_mark`
- Missing </blockquote> tag in html
- after update from 2.5 to 2024.01.24, vimwiki doesn't work HOT 3
- Data lost when the wiki name is truncated.
- Avoid listing deprecated functions in command autocomplete
- backport ZettelBacklinks as VimwikiGenerateBacklinks HOT 1
- [[file:]] with space is not working
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from vimwiki.